473,769 Members | 2,377 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

MS Access Banking Solution

I am going to develop a Banking Solution for very small branches of a
Bank. The branches are standalone and no remote transactions will be
made i.e. only the individual branch will be under networking and there
will be no networking between the branches. The branches have maximum
10000 (ten thousand) customer accounts, maximum 200 daily (60000
yearly) transactions and maximum 3 to 4 concurrent users. The solution
will provide voucher generation, interest calculation and interest
anticipation, batch posting etc. facility. The system will generate
over 100 reports, some of them are too complex (manipulate data from
several tables, calculate, summaries, make group etc.).

I intend to develop the solution with MS Access as Database, Visual
Basic as Tool and Crystal Report as Report Builder.

Should I ?

Proceed with the Idea.
Split the transactions Table for different types of Accounts. There
will be about maximum 40000 records yearly.
Split the Cheque (Account Wise of Year wise) information Table which
will store 500000 yearly records.
Some one are suggesting using different database for different types of
account. Should I go for that.
Your valued suggestion will help me a lot to take decision.

M. A. Zubair

Bangladesh

Nov 13 '05 #1
3 5470
ma******@gmail. com wrote:
I am going to develop a Banking Solution for very small branches of a
Bank. The branches are standalone and no remote transactions will be
made i.e. only the individual branch will be under networking and there
will be no networking between the branches. The branches have maximum
10000 (ten thousand) customer accounts, maximum 200 daily (60000
yearly) transactions and maximum 3 to 4 concurrent users. The solution
will provide voucher generation, interest calculation and interest
anticipation, batch posting etc. facility. The system will generate
over 100 reports, some of them are too complex (manipulate data from
several tables, calculate, summaries, make group etc.).

I intend to develop the solution with MS Access as Database, Visual
Basic as Tool and Crystal Report as Report Builder.

Should I ?

Proceed with the Idea.
If I were President of the any of the banks, it's unlikely that I would
approve of the use of JET (Access) as the database for the financial
transactions. I have little or no confidence in the security of this
technology against any determined and skillful attack.

If I were you I would consult a reputable lawyer about my liability
should the security of the system be broached and money stolen.

I think I am voting, "No", to proceeding with the idea here, but I
really do not have sufficient appreciation of the facts of the situation
to do so.
The weakest part of Access-JET may be JET. If you MUST go this way,
perhaps, you could consider Access for your user interface and MS-SQL
for your database.
Split the transactions Table for different types of Accounts. There
will be about maximum 40000 records yearly.
No.
Split the Cheque (Account Wise of Year wise) information Table which
will store 500000 yearly records.
No.
Some one are suggesting using different database for different types of
account. Should I go for that.
No.
Your valued suggestion will help me a lot to take decision.
It seems by the suggestions that you have received that the banks are
not over-flowing with database experts. I can understand that the
development budget may be low but have you considered purchasing a
shrink-wrapped solution, or hiring someone who has successfully created
something similar in the past?
M. A. Zubair

Bangladesh


--
--
Lyle

"The aim of those who try to control thought is always the same. They
find one single explanation of the world, one system of thought and
action that will (they believe) cover everything; and then they try to
impose that on all thinking people."
- Gilbert Highet
Nov 13 '05 #2
On 30 Apr 2005 03:00:11 -0700, ma******@gmail. com wrote:

If my bank were to build its accounts software on MsAccess (a Jet
database), I wouldn't know how quickly to take my business elsewhere.

-Tom.
I am going to develop a Banking Solution for very small branches of a
Bank. The branches are standalone and no remote transactions will be
made i.e. only the individual branch will be under networking and there
will be no networking between the branches. The branches have maximum
10000 (ten thousand) customer accounts, maximum 200 daily (60000
yearly) transactions and maximum 3 to 4 concurrent users. The solution
will provide voucher generation, interest calculation and interest
anticipation , batch posting etc. facility. The system will generate
over 100 reports, some of them are too complex (manipulate data from
several tables, calculate, summaries, make group etc.).

I intend to develop the solution with MS Access as Database, Visual
Basic as Tool and Crystal Report as Report Builder.

Should I ?

Proceed with the Idea.
Split the transactions Table for different types of Accounts. There
will be about maximum 40000 records yearly.
Split the Cheque (Account Wise of Year wise) information Table which
will store 500000 yearly records.
Some one are suggesting using different database for different types of
account. Should I go for that.
Your valued suggestion will help me a lot to take decision.

M. A. Zubair

Bangladesh


Nov 13 '05 #3
Mazubair,
I'm with Lyle on this. The volume of data is big enough, the likely growth
in concurrent connections large enough, and the need for security strong
enough, that Jet/Access will be more trouble than it is worth. In order of
preference: a packaged solution from a vendor that has been in business for
a while and has an established reputation for reliability, a mix of packaged
and custom solutions using a reporting tool like Access or Crystal Reports,
rolling your own in something like PostgreSQL or SQL Server. This to me is
a strong candidate for buy instead of build.

--
Alan Webb
kn*******@SPAMh otmail.com
"It's not IT, it's IS
<ma******@gmail .com> wrote in message
news:11******** **************@ o13g2000cwo.goo glegroups.com.. .
I am going to develop a Banking Solution for very small branches of a
Bank. The branches are standalone and no remote transactions will be
made i.e. only the individual branch will be under networking and there
will be no networking between the branches. The branches have maximum
10000 (ten thousand) customer accounts, maximum 200 daily (60000
yearly) transactions and maximum 3 to 4 concurrent users. The solution
will provide voucher generation, interest calculation and interest
anticipation, batch posting etc. facility. The system will generate
over 100 reports, some of them are too complex (manipulate data from
several tables, calculate, summaries, make group etc.).

I intend to develop the solution with MS Access as Database, Visual
Basic as Tool and Crystal Report as Report Builder.

Should I ?

Proceed with the Idea.
Split the transactions Table for different types of Accounts. There
will be about maximum 40000 records yearly.
Split the Cheque (Account Wise of Year wise) information Table which
will store 500000 yearly records.
Some one are suggesting using different database for different types of
account. Should I go for that.
Your valued suggestion will help me a lot to take decision.

M. A. Zubair

Bangladesh

Nov 13 '05 #4

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

13
2783
by: ashu | last post by:
hi to all, Please read the following ques. first. assume that a bank maintains 2 kinds of accounts for customers one called as savings accounts & other as current account. the savings account provides simple interest & withdraw facilities but no check book facilities. the current account provides check book facilities but no interest.
10
7426
by: John Phelan | last post by:
I read an article by, by Mike Groh, in Access-VB-SQL Advisor Magazine, Week 37 that concerns me quite a bit on distributing Access Applications commercially. First I need to describe a "commercial version" of my application that I hope to distribute after completing all the beta testing: A. It was developed using MS AccessXP Pro (developers edition), B. It has a front end MyApplication.mdb and a MyAppBbackend_be.mde; the front end is...
2
2292
by: mazubair | last post by:
I am going to develop a Banking Solution for very small branches of a Bank. The branches are standalone and no remote transactions will be made i.e. only the individual branch will be under networking and there will be no networking between the branches. The branches have maximum 10000 (ten thousand) customer accounts, maximum 200 daily transactions (120000 yearly including processed transactions i.e. interest, charges etc.) and maximum 3...
4
3393
by: KnightKnives | last post by:
Is there anyone out there who could help me find the resources I need in order to make this application. I have done a lot of work with 2.0 engine then upgraded to 97; now have 2003. I have struggled with coding in VBA and know some VBA. Have bookkeeping degree but want to apply as much as I can with the limited knowledge that I have with VBA. Just some basics would help me. Also, I am new to this forum and new to using the net. I am...
13
1824
by: Peter Chant | last post by:
I'm considering setting a website up for a club. I do not plan the contents to be for public consumption, but on the other hand I'm not going to have anything on there that is confidential, that would cause a problem if it went further. The basic reason is for publicity of club events. I want to make it easy to use. I suspect a login with a password would be too much effort for most people. I also note that computer literacy is not a...
11
6657
by: cj | last post by:
Lets assume all calculations are done with decimal data types so things are as precise as possible. When it comes to the final rounding to cut a check to pay dividends for example in VB rounding seems to be done like this 3.435 = 3.44 3.445 = 3.44 Dim decNbr1 As Decimal
7
7285
by: Bernard D | last post by:
Hi, I'm using Access 97. I can run a query that finds a number of records, I then need to access these results to build a formatted text file containing all of the results. There will be 25 fields per record and potentially any number of records. I would have liked to have just produced a report sent to file but
0
929
by: bprasanth | last post by:
How can I access the one *.fmx (i.e Bankmain master form file) to another *.fmx(*.Bank_Transactions form) without specifying the full path of the form for example D:\Banking\BANKING.fmx . If any one know this please send me the full description as soon as possible. B.Prasanth nair (Specialization in Oracle9i) E-mail: bprasanth_nair@yahoo.co.in
27
4319
by: agins | last post by:
I have used nearly every version of ACT for more than 15-years. Currently have 5,000 records in one database and the program seems unable to smoothly handle that many. Am starting a new business that will have perhaps 20,000 records and considering ACCESS (although I dread the learning curve). Does anyone have experience comparing the two? Does anyone know how VISTA will interface w ith each? Steve Agins
0
9589
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However, people are often confused as to whether an ONU can Work As a Router. In this blog post, we’ll explore What is ONU, What Is Router, ONU & Router’s main usage, and What is the difference between ONU and Router. Let’s take a closer look ! Part I. Meaning of...
0
9423
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can effortlessly switch the default language on Windows 10 without reinstalling. I'll walk you through it. First, let's disable language synchronization. With a Microsoft account, language settings sync across devices. To prevent any complications,...
0
10222
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ers, it seems that the internal comparison operator "<=>" tries to promote arguments from unsigned to signed. This is as boiled down as I can make it. Here is my compilation command: g++-12 -std=c++20 -Wnarrowing bit_field.cpp Here is the code in...
0
10050
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ven tapestry of website design and digital marketing. It's not merely about having a website; it's about crafting an immersive digital experience that captivates audiences and drives business growth. The Art of Business Website Design Your website is...
1
7413
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 1 May 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ome a new presenter, Adolph Dupré who will be discussing some powerful techniques for using class modules. He will explain when you may want to use classes instead of User Defined Types (UDT). For example, to manage the data in unbound forms. Adolph will...
0
6675
by: conductexam | last post by:
I have .net C# application in which I am extracting data from word file and save it in database particularly. To store word all data as it is I am converting the whole word file firstly in HTML and then checking html paragraph one by one. At the time of converting from word file to html my equations which are in the word document file was convert into image. Globals.ThisAddIn.Application.ActiveDocument.Select();...
0
5310
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The last exercise I practiced was to create a LAN-to-LAN VPN between two Pfsense firewalls, by using IPSEC protocols. I succeeded, with both firewalls in the same network. But I'm wondering if it's possible to do the same thing, with 2 Pfsense firewalls...
0
5448
by: adsilva | last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
3
2815
bsmnconsultancy
by: bsmnconsultancy | last post by:
In today's digital era, a well-designed website is crucial for businesses looking to succeed. Whether you're a small business owner or a large corporation in Toronto, having a strong online presence can significantly impact your brand's success. BSMN Consultancy, a leader in Website Development in Toronto offers valuable insights into creating effective websites that not only look great but also perform exceptionally well. In this comprehensive...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.